Dog owners encouraged to seize the opportunity to 'Spay the Day'

Cook Shire Council is encouraging all dog owners to Spay the Day, with the final round of its successful desexing program for the 2023-24 financial year scheduled to take place from Tuesday, 30 April until Thursday, 2 May 2024.

QRA Damage Assessment and Reconstruction Monitoring Audits

Please be advised that officers from the Queensland Reconstruction Authority will be in Cook Shire between Monday 15 April and Friday 19 April checking on homes and businesses damaged by the severe rainfall and flooding of Tropical Cyclone Jasper.

Fresh faces, fresh ideas: Cook Shire welcomes its new Council.

Cook Shire Council is pleased to announce the official swearing-in of its newly elected Councillors at the Post-election meeting held today Tuesday, 9 April 2024. The ceremony, administered by CEO Brian Joiner, marked the commencement of their duties in serving the community.

Enhanced Accessibility at William Daku Park with New Wheelchair-Friendly Picnic Tables

Cook Shire Council is excited to announce a significant enhancement to the accessibility and aesthetics of William Daku Park with the installation of two brand-new timber-look aluminium picnic tables, designed to accommodate wheelchair users.
